css動(dòng)畫(huà)樣式插件 css動(dòng)畫(huà)教程

5、CSS樣式之動(dòng)畫(huà)效果

下面說(shuō)一下制作動(dòng)畫(huà)的步驟:一:自己要清楚自己所要做的動(dòng)畫(huà)的一個(gè)整體形態(tài),首先就是要建模二:拆分動(dòng)畫(huà)形態(tài),就是每幀的形態(tài),或者是一個(gè)時(shí)長(zhǎng)動(dòng)畫(huà)的開(kāi)始和結(jié)束形態(tài),中間過(guò)程的變化形態(tài)。

創(chuàng)新互聯(lián)建站服務(wù)項(xiàng)目包括鎮(zhèn)雄網(wǎng)站建設(shè)、鎮(zhèn)雄網(wǎng)站制作、鎮(zhèn)雄網(wǎng)頁(yè)制作以及鎮(zhèn)雄網(wǎng)絡(luò)營(yíng)銷(xiāo)策劃等。多年來(lái),我們專(zhuān)注于互聯(lián)網(wǎng)行業(yè),利用自身積累的技術(shù)優(yōu)勢(shì)、行業(yè)經(jīng)驗(yàn)、深度合作伙伴關(guān)系等,向廣大中小型企業(yè)、政府機(jī)構(gòu)等提供互聯(lián)網(wǎng)行業(yè)的解決方案,鎮(zhèn)雄網(wǎng)站推廣取得了明顯的社會(huì)效益與經(jīng)濟(jì)效益。目前,我們服務(wù)的客戶以成都為中心已經(jīng)輻射到鎮(zhèn)雄省份的部分城市,未來(lái)相信會(huì)繼續(xù)擴(kuò)大服務(wù)區(qū)域并繼續(xù)獲得客戶的支持與信任!

實(shí)現(xiàn)如圖所示的動(dòng)畫(huà)效果:預(yù)載動(dòng)畫(huà)一:雙旋圈在兩個(gè)不同方向旋轉(zhuǎn)的圓圈。我們對(duì)內(nèi)圈的轉(zhuǎn)速定義了一個(gè)CSS代碼,即內(nèi)圈比外圈的速率快2倍。

css3的動(dòng)畫(huà)是使元素從一種樣式逐漸變化為另一種樣式的效果。 CSS3Gen - CSS3動(dòng)畫(huà)生成器CSS3Gen為你提供了一個(gè)易于使用的可以快速生成基本動(dòng)畫(huà)的動(dòng)畫(huà)生成器。

設(shè)置動(dòng)畫(huà)的舞臺(tái)HTML與之前文章里的示例非常相似。

可以使用CSS中的animation屬性和@keyframes規(guī)則來(lái)實(shí)現(xiàn)圖片自上而下落下來(lái)的動(dòng)畫(huà)效果。

如何用css制作動(dòng)畫(huà)效果?

你可以從Github上下載代碼,然后你只需要添加CSS文件到HTML頁(yè)面,然后在HTML元素中引用你需要的動(dòng)畫(huà)的CSS類(lèi)即可。

需要用到這個(gè)屬性animation-play-state: paused | running,它表示動(dòng)畫(huà)的兩個(gè)狀態(tài):暫停和運(yùn)行。

下面是動(dòng)畫(huà)實(shí)現(xiàn)所需要用到的幾個(gè)css3屬性。 perspective:用來(lái)實(shí)現(xiàn)一個(gè)3d的場(chǎng)景 寫(xiě)3D效果的第一步是要?jiǎng)?chuàng)建一個(gè)3D場(chǎng)景,即索要實(shí)現(xiàn)效果的模塊。這里用到了 perspective 屬性和 perspective-origin 屬性。

使用css3制作旋轉(zhuǎn)動(dòng)畫(huà)的思路首先我們需要使用div畫(huà)出這8個(gè)圖標(biāo),我們通過(guò)觀察可以發(fā)現(xiàn),8個(gè)圖標(biāo)可以分成4組div,并且可以將圓形等分為8份,這樣可以方便我們隨后的操作。

CSS如何實(shí)現(xiàn)動(dòng)畫(huà)?

1、實(shí)現(xiàn)如圖所示的動(dòng)畫(huà)效果:預(yù)載動(dòng)畫(huà)一:雙旋圈在兩個(gè)不同方向旋轉(zhuǎn)的圓圈。我們對(duì)內(nèi)圈的轉(zhuǎn)速定義了一個(gè)CSS代碼,即內(nèi)圈比外圈的速率快2倍。

2、用 border-top和border-bottom設(shè)置上下兩個(gè)弧形,便于后面的動(dòng)畫(huà)設(shè)置。最后,為了使其旋轉(zhuǎn)起來(lái),需要用animation和@keyframes屬性,具體代碼如下:注意:使用animation和@keyframes動(dòng)畫(huà)時(shí),注意瀏覽器的兼容性。

3、下面說(shuō)一下制作動(dòng)畫(huà)的步驟:一:自己要清楚自己所要做的動(dòng)畫(huà)的一個(gè)整體形態(tài),首先就是要建模二:拆分動(dòng)畫(huà)形態(tài),就是每幀的形態(tài),或者是一個(gè)時(shí)長(zhǎng)動(dòng)畫(huà)的開(kāi)始和結(jié)束形態(tài),中間過(guò)程的變化形態(tài)。

4、使用css3制作旋轉(zhuǎn)動(dòng)畫(huà)的思路首先我們需要使用div畫(huà)出這8個(gè)圖標(biāo),我們通過(guò)觀察可以發(fā)現(xiàn),8個(gè)圖標(biāo)可以分成4組div,并且可以將圓形等分為8份,這樣可以方便我們隨后的操作。

5、手動(dòng)控制動(dòng)畫(huà)執(zhí)行現(xiàn)在我們實(shí)現(xiàn)當(dāng)鼠標(biāo)懸浮于圖片時(shí)才讓它動(dòng)起來(lái),鼠標(biāo)離開(kāi)讓它靜止。需要用到這個(gè)屬性animation-play-state: paused | running,它表示動(dòng)畫(huà)的兩個(gè)狀態(tài):暫停和運(yùn)行。

如何用jQuery封裝animate.css代碼

首先雙擊打開(kāi)HBuilderX工具,新建一個(gè)HTML5頁(yè)面,并引入jquery文件,如下圖所示。在標(biāo)簽元素內(nèi),插入一個(gè)label和button,如下圖所示。保存代碼并打開(kāi)瀏覽器,預(yù)覽頁(yè)面效果結(jié)果出現(xiàn)報(bào)錯(cuò)。

(selector).animate({params},speed,callback);必需的 params 參數(shù)定義形成動(dòng)畫(huà)的 CSS 屬性。可選的 speed 參數(shù)規(guī)定效果的時(shí)長(zhǎng)。它可以取以下值:slow、fast 或毫秒。

首先在head中引入下載的animate.css文件 然后你想要哪個(gè)元素進(jìn)行動(dòng)畫(huà),就給那個(gè)元素添加上animated類(lèi) 以及特定的動(dòng)畫(huà)類(lèi)名,animated是每個(gè)要進(jìn)行動(dòng)畫(huà)的元素都必須要添加的類(lèi)。

使用jQuery實(shí)現(xiàn)動(dòng)畫(huà),代碼已經(jīng)簡(jiǎn)單得不能再簡(jiǎn)化了:只需要一行代碼!讓我們先來(lái)看看jQuery內(nèi)置的幾種動(dòng)畫(huà)樣式:show / hide直接以無(wú)參數(shù)形式調(diào)用show()和hide(),會(huì)顯示和隱藏DOM元素。

使用jquery往往可用一兩行代碼實(shí)現(xiàn)javascript原生代碼幾十甚至上百行代碼才能實(shí)現(xiàn)的功能。但是jquery是一個(gè)特化的框架,它不是一個(gè)完整的解決方案,仍然離不開(kāi)javascript。

當(dāng)前標(biāo)題:css動(dòng)畫(huà)樣式插件 css動(dòng)畫(huà)教程
文章來(lái)源:http://muchs.cn/article7/dggchij.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供微信小程序、企業(yè)網(wǎng)站制作、手機(jī)網(wǎng)站建設(shè)、ChatGPT自適應(yīng)網(wǎng)站、Google

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

搜索引擎優(yōu)化